"Allegro16.5中进行SI仿真及IBIS转化问题分析和解决方法"

需积分: 5 1 下载量 102 浏览量 更新于2024-01-27 收藏 1.23MB PDF 举报
"Allegro16.5-中进行SI-仿真"是一项通过使用Cadence Allegro16.5软件进行信号完整性仿真的任务。在进行仿真之前,需要相应的IBIS模型文件,并将其转换为Cadence需要的DML文件。为此,我们已经下载了一个名为"cyclone3.ibs"的IBIS文件,它是Altera公司的Cyclone3器件的IBIS模型。 为了将该IBIS文件转化为DML文件,首先需要打开Allegro16.5的Model Integrity工具。在打开Model Integrity后,选择"File"菜单下的"Open"选项来打开需要转换的IBIS文件。在文件打开后,可以看到IBIS文件的内容。 然后,点击IBIS文件中的"Cyclone3",然后右键单击该文件,在弹出的菜单中选择"IBIS to DML"选项,以实现IBIS到DML的转换。然而,在进行转换时出现了错误。 查看转换过程的LOG文件,可以发现以下说明信息。首先,警告提示"CYCLONE3_sstl18c1_cio_d10s"的最大下降斜率的Ramp值与相应的TV曲线计算结果存在显著差异,并已进行了调整。然后,错误提示TV曲线的起始时间有问题。 这种情况实际上表明在转换IBIS模型到DML过程中出现了许多错误。其中,警告提示了最大下降斜率的值与原始TV曲线计算结果不同,需要进行修正。此外,错误提示TV曲线的起始时间有问题。这些错误可能会影响仿真结果的准确性和可靠性。 为了解决这些问题,可以尝试以下步骤: 1. 检查所下载的IBIS文件的完整性和准确性。确保文件不损坏或错误,并与所需的器件型号和规格相匹配。 2. 针对警告提示的最大下降斜率的问题,可以尝试手动修改该值,使其与原始TV曲线计算结果相匹配。这可能需要一些电路知识和实验数据,以确保修正的值在合理范围内。 3. 对于TV曲线起始时间的错误,可以检查IBIS文件中是否存在错误或缺失的参数。如果有缺失的参数,可以尝试根据IBIS规范和器件规格手动添加或修改这些参数。 4. 如果以上步骤都无法解决问题,可以尝试联系器件制造商或供应商,寻求他们的技术支持和建议。他们可能能够提供针对特定器件的更准确的IBIS模型文件或解决方案。 总的来说,"Allegro16.5-中进行SI-仿真"任务涉及IBIS模型到DML文件的转换和信号完整性仿真。在转换过程中可能会出现错误,特别是与TV曲线和斜率相关的问题。为了解决这些问题,需要仔细检查和修正IBIS文件及其参数,并可能需要与器件制造商或供应商进行沟通和协作。正确转换和使用准确的模型文件对于获得可靠的仿真结果至关重要。